한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Con la popolarità di Internet e l'accelerazione della trasformazione digitale aziendale, la domanda di sviluppo Java continua a crescere. Molte aziende hanno bisogno di creare applicazioni web efficienti e stabili, backend di applicazioni mobili e sistemi di elaborazione di big data, che offrano agli sviluppatori Java ricche opportunità di attività. Tuttavia, la concorrenza sul mercato sta diventando sempre più agguerrita.
Da un lato, un gran numero di sviluppatori si riversano nel mercato, rendendo più difficile ottenere incarichi. D’altra parte, il continuo aggiornamento della tecnologia richiede agli sviluppatori di apprendere continuamente nuove competenze e strutture per rimanere competitivi. Ad esempio, l’ascesa della tecnologia nativa del cloud richiede che gli sviluppatori Java abbiano familiarità con tecnologie come la containerizzazione e l’architettura dei microservizi.
Allo stesso tempo, la segmentazione del settore ha posto anche requisiti più elevati per gli sviluppatori Java. Nel campo della tecnologia finanziaria, gli sviluppatori devono avere una profonda conoscenza dell’elaborazione delle transazioni ad alta concorrenza e della sicurezza dei dati nel campo medico e sanitario, devono capire come gestire enormi quantità di dati medici e garantire la conformità del sistema;
Inoltre, la complessità dei progetti sta aumentando. Non si tratta più di una semplice implementazione di funzioni, ma è necessario considerare molti fattori come la scalabilità del sistema, l'ottimizzazione delle prestazioni e l'esperienza dell'utente. Ciò richiede che gli sviluppatori Java dispongano di capacità di progettazione dell'architettura di sistema e di gestione dei progetti.
Per gli sviluppatori Java è fondamentale migliorare la qualità complessiva. Non solo devi essere tecnicamente competente, ma devi anche avere buone capacità di comunicazione, lavoro di squadra e risoluzione dei problemi. Quando si accettano incarichi, essere in grado di comprendere chiaramente le esigenze dei clienti, valutare accuratamente la difficoltà e i rischi del progetto e formulare piani di sviluppo ragionevoli.
In breve, le attività di sviluppo Java sono piene di opportunità ma devono anche affrontare sfide. Solo apprendendo e migliorando costantemente le proprie capacità è possibile distinguersi in questo mercato altamente competitivo e raggiungere obiettivi di valore personale e di sviluppo professionale.